City Overview
Nestled in the breathtaking Sierra Nevada mountains, Homewood, California, is a picturesque community that offers a harmonious blend of natural beauty, outdoor adventure, and a warm, inviting atmosphere. Situated on the western shore of Lake Tahoe, this charming town is renowned for its stunning lakefront views, rich history, and vibrant culture. Tourism Appeal
Tourism plays a vital role in Homewood's economy, attracting visitors year-round. In the winter months, the nearby ski resorts, including Homewood Mountain Resort, provide excellent skiing and snowboarding opportunities. When summer arrives, the stunning blue waters of Lake Tahoe become a playground for swimming, kayaking, and paddleboarding. Jobs and Commuting
Employment opportunities in Homewood are diverse, with many residents working in tourism, hospitality, and local businesses. The town's economy is bolstered by its seasonal tourism, which creates jobs in various sectors. For those commuting to nearby cities, such as Tahoe City or Truckee, the scenic drives provide a pleasant commute, allowing residents to enjoy the stunning landscapes as they travel to work.
